How Do Technicians Inspect Pipes with a Scope?

A sewer scope camera is a small, water-resistant, high-resolution camera that's attached to a flexible cable and inserted into a home's sewer line to check for potential problems or damage. Equipped with a strong light source, the camera takes video footage and images of the inside of the sewer line, which is shown on a screen in real-time. Sewer scoping inspectors can track where the camera is located inside the sewer line by stamping the cable at regular intervals. Sewer scope cameras are made to offer a comprehensive look at the sewer line's condition, allowing for early awareness and repairs of any problems or damage.

The inspector will check for blockages, cracks, leaks, or other damage to the sewer line during a sewer scope inspection. The camera will also show the general condition of the sewer line, including its age, materials, and any symptoms of wear. Sewer scoping inspectors are usually qualified professionals using specialized tools. The inspection can take anywhere from a half hour to several hours, depending on the size and complexity of the sewer line.

Why Should You Seek a Sewer Scope Inspection?

Sewer scoping has the benefit of providing a well-rounded look at the sewer line and telling homebuyers if the home is a good investment, now and in the future. The somewhat small price of this service will save you money and alleviate your stress in the end. Some of the advantages of a sewer scoping inspection service are:

  • Identify potential issues: A sewer scope inspection can expose any existing or potential problems with the sewer line, such as cracks, blockages, or leaks. Understanding these problems ahead of time can help you make a wise decision about whether to proceed with the purchase or arrange for restorations with the seller.
  • Avoid unexpected costs: Sewer line replacements or repairs can be expensive, so spotting any problems early on can help you avoid unexpected costs after you've already bought the home.
  • Plan for future repairs: Even if there aren't any problems found during the inspection, a sewer scope inspection report can help you understand the condition and age of the sewer line, allowing you to plan and budget for potential replacements or repairs in the future.

Other main reasons why potential homebuyers should get a sewer scoping inspection service are:

  • To prevent health hazards: A damaged sewer line can lead to sewage leaks and backups, which can create bad smells and pose health hazards to you and your family.
  • To ensure compliance with regulations: Some areas need a sewer scope inspection before a home can be sold or before extensive repairs can be done. A sewer scope inspection service can help ensure adherence with these rules.
